mysql怎么配置端口
时间 : 2023-08-06 13:22: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

在MySQL中配置端口可以通过以下步骤完成:

1. 打开MySQL配置文件:首先,通过文本编辑器打开MySQL的配置文件。在Unix/Linux系统中,配置文件通常位于`/etc/mysql/my.cnf`或`/etc/my.cnf`;在Windows系统中,配置文件通常位于`C:\Program Files\MySQL\MySQL Server [version]\my.ini`。注意:如果你使用的是非默认安装路径,请找到相应的配置文件。

2. 定位绑定地址和端口:在配置文件中,找到`[mysqld]`节,这是MySQL服务器的主要配置节。在该节下,查找到以下两行(如果不存在,则可以手动添加):

bind-address=127.0.0.1 # 绑定地址,这里默认为本地

port=3306 # 默认端口为3306

这两行分别用于指定MySQL服务器绑定的IP地址和端口。通常,`bind-address`默认设置为`127.0.0.1`,即只能通过本地访问MySQL。如果想要允许远程访问,可以将该地址改为服务器的IP地址。而`port`用于指定MySQL监听的端口,默认为3306。你可以根据需要修改端口号,但确保不要与其他正在使用的端口冲突。

3. 保存配置文件:保存并关闭配置文件。

4. 重启MySQL服务器:重启MySQL服务器以使配置生效。在Unix/Linux系统中,可以使用以下命令重启:

sudo service mysql restart

在Windows系统中,可以通过服务管理器或者使用以下命令重启:

net stop mysql

net start mysql

5. 验证端口配置:验证MySQL服务器的端口配置是否生效。可以通过以下方法之一:

- 运行命令 `netstat -an`(在Windows系统)或者 `netstat -an | grep LISTEN`(在Unix/Linux系统)查看正在监听的端口。确保端口号与配置文件中设置的端口一致。

- 使用telnet命令在本地或者远程主机上测试连接MySQL服务器的指定端口。例如,`telnet 127.0.0.1 3306`来测试本地是否可以连接MySQL服务器的3306端口。

通过以上步骤,你可以成功配置MySQL的端口。请注意,修改配置文件后,重启MySQL服务器是必要的,以确保配置生效。